Re: how far was your longest trip in a bongo
2500 miles over 3 weeks last summer, down to the South of France and back, stopping off at various places along the way. Currently in France again now, heading home on Monday. Really recommend the Eurotunnel too - free with Tesco vouchers!

Re: No. 1 manifold stud
Get it done as soon as you can. We've had 2 go - first one pretty simple job to drill old one out and replace.
Second time, a whole lot more needed to be done, with replacement manifolds, gaskets, etc. needed.
